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a vibrating sand shaking-out apparatus not only securely holding the workpiece to be subjected to sand shaking-out on a vibration stand plate with a clamp fixture, but also not affected by heat in the heated workpiece, and in which equipment is miniaturized as well, so as to attain cost reduction. <P>SOLUTION: In the vibrating sand shaking-out apparatus, a workpiece 3 is arranged on a vibration stand plate 1, and sand stuck to the workpiece 3 is shaken out by the vibration of the vibration stand plate 1, the workpiece 3 is clamped with a clamp lever 6, further, the clamp lever 6 is operated with an air spring 10, so as to firmly hold the workpiece 3, the heat of the workpiece 3 is conducted to the air spring 10 via the clamp lever 6, so as to protect the air spring 10 from heat, and also, the equipment is miniaturized.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2008,JPO&amp;INPIT

自動車部品等、各種機械部品の多くは鋳造により成型される。鋳造された鋳造物(ワーク)には多量の砂が付着しており、この付着している砂を落とす作業が必要となる。         Many machine parts such as automobile parts are molded by casting. A large amount of sand adheres to the cast product (work), and it is necessary to remove the adhered sand.

ワークの砂落とし装置として、従来、図2に示すものが知られている。図2において、振動台板1上にシリンダー2とワーク3が配置される。振動台板1は振動モーター4によって振動を受ける。振動台板1上に配置されたシリンダー2のシリンダーロッド5先端にはクランプレバー6が連結される。クランプレバー6はシリンダー2の操作でピンジョイント7を回転し、ワーク3を強固に固定する。ワーク3はこのような状態で振動台板1から振動を受け、ワーク3に付着している砂を落とす。         2. Description of the Related Art Conventionally, a workpiece sand removal device shown in FIG. 2 is known. In FIG. 2, a cylinder 2 and a work 3 are arranged on a vibration base plate 1. The vibration base plate 1 is vibrated by a vibration motor 4. A clamp lever 6 is connected to the tip of the cylinder rod 5 of the cylinder 2 arranged on the vibration base plate 1. The clamp lever 6 rotates the pin joint 7 by operating the cylinder 2 to firmly fix the work 3. In this state, the work 3 receives vibration from the vibration base plate 1 and drops the sand adhering to the work 3.

しかし、図2の装置はワーク3をクランプレバー6で固定する際にシリンダー2を用いるので、設備が大型化されてコストが大幅に増大する。       However, since the apparatus of FIG. 2 uses the cylinder 2 when the workpiece 3 is fixed by the clamp lever 6, the equipment is increased in size and the cost is greatly increased.

また、ワークの砂落とし装置として、図3に示すものも特願2006−080497号として出願されている。図3において、基台8上に弾性支持部材9を介して振動台板1が載置される。この振動台板1にはワーク3をはさんで保持する空気バネ10が設置され、さらに、この振動台板1は振動モーター4と連結されている。         As a workpiece sand removal device, the one shown in FIG. 3 has been filed as Japanese Patent Application No. 2006-080497. In FIG. 3, the vibration base plate 1 is placed on a base 8 via an elastic support member 9. The vibration base plate 1 is provided with an air spring 10 for holding the workpiece 3 therebetween. Further, the vibration base plate 1 is connected to a vibration motor 4.

本発明装置は図1に示されるように、まず、振動台板1上にワーク3を配置する。ワーク3に付着された砂は振動台板1の振動によって落下する。振動は振動モーター4によって起こされる。As shown in FIG. 1, the apparatus of the present invention first places a work 3 on a vibration base plate 1. The sand adhered to the work 3 falls due to the vibration of the vibration base plate 1. The vibration is caused by the vibration motor 4.

ワーク3はクランプレバー6でクランプされ、クランプレバー6は空気バネ10で操作され、これによりワーク3を強固に保持する。クランプレバー6はピンジョイント7を中心にして回動し、先端でワーク3を押えつけてクランプするとともに、末端で空気バネ10に連結され、これにより、空気バネ10を熱の影響から保護する。The workpiece 3 is clamped by the clamp lever 6, and the clamp lever 6 is operated by the air spring 10, thereby holding the workpiece 3 firmly. The clamp lever 6 rotates around the pin joint 7 and presses and clamps the work 3 at the tip, and is connected to the air spring 10 at the end, thereby protecting the air spring 10 from the influence of heat.

本発明装置は図2の公知技術におけるシリンダー2の代わりに空気バネ10を取りつけたことに存し、あるいは図3、図4、図5の従来技術に示すように、ワーククランプガイド11、クランプロッド12および抑え具13の代わりにクランプレバー6を用い、これによりワーク3からの熱をクランプレバー6で吸収して空気バネ10を熱から保護し、かつシリンダー2の代わりに空気バネ10を用いたことにより設備を小型化したことに存する。The apparatus of the present invention resides in that an air spring 10 is attached in place of the cylinder 2 in the known technique of FIG. 2, or, as shown in the prior art of FIGS. 3, 4, and 5, a work clamp guide 11 and a clamp rod. 12 and the clamp 13 are used instead of the clamp 13, thereby absorbing the heat from the work 3 by the clamp lever 6 to protect the air spring 10 from heat, and using the air spring 10 instead of the cylinder 2. This means that the equipment has been downsized.

以上のとおり、本発明装置はシリンダーの代わりに空気バネ10を用い、クランプ治具としてクランプレバー6を用いることにより、ワーク3からの熱をクランプレバー6に吸収し、かつ空気バネ10をワーク3の熱から保護するとともに、設備を小型化でき、産業上の利用可能性が高い。As described above, the apparatus of the present invention uses the air spring 10 instead of the cylinder, and uses the clamp lever 6 as a clamp jig, so that the heat from the work 3 is absorbed by the clamp lever 6 and the air spring 10 is moved to the work 3. In addition to protecting from heat, the equipment can be miniaturized and the industrial applicability is high.
